Q: Is 309,092 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 309,092 is a composite number.

Why is 309,092 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 309,092 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 14 19 28 38 49 76 83 98 133 166 196 266 332 532 581 931 1,162 1,577 1,862 2,324 3,154 3,724 4,067 6,308 8,134 11,039 16,268 22,078 44,156 77,273 154,546 and 309,092, with no remainder.

Since 309,092 cannot be divided by just 1 and 309,092, it is a composite number.
